Students may have poor school attendance due to a variety of factors, including health issues, family responsibilities, or socioeconomic challenges that make it difficult for them to attend regularly. Mental health concerns, such as anxiety or depression, can also play a significant role in their willingness to engage in school. Additionally, a lack of connection to the school environment or negative experiences, such as bullying, may further discourage attendance. Addressing these issues holistically is crucial for improving attendance rates.

School uniforms can improve attendance by creating a sense of belonging and equality among students, reducing instances of peer pressure related to clothing choices, and potentially decreasing bullying based on attire. When students feel a sense of unity and belonging, they may be more motivated to attend school regularly.

Yes, students can receive referrals for truancy at school. Truancy refers to unexcused absences from class, and schools often have policies in place to address this issue. Consequences can include disciplinary actions such as referrals, meetings with parents, or intervention programs aimed at improving attendance. It’s important for students to understand their school’s attendance policies to avoid such referrals.
